Lets compare vitamin content per 1 kilogram of Valencia Oranges vs Bread, white, commercially prepared, low sodium, no salt:
- 1 kilogram of Valencia Oranges has more Vitamin C than Bread, white, commercially prepared, low sodium, no salt.
- While 1 kg of Bread, white, commercially prepared, low sodium, no salt contains 5.4 times more Vitamin B1, 8.5 times more Vitamin B2, 14.5 times more Vitamin B3, 1.6 times more Vitamin B5 and 2.8 times more Vitamin B9 than Raw Valencia Oranges.
- Both Valencia Oranges and Bread, white, commercially prepared, low sodium, no salt provide similar amounts of Vitamin B6 per one kilogram.
- 1 kilogram of Valencia Oranges have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B3
- 1 kilogram of Bread, white, commercially prepared, low sodium, no salt have insufficient amounts of Vitamin C
- Both Raw Valencia Oranges as well as Bread, white, commercially prepared, low sodium, no salt have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in one kilogram.
Comparing minerals per 1 kilogram for Valencia Oranges vs Bread, white, commercially prepared, low sodium, no salt:
- 1 kilogram of Valencia Oranges has 1.5 times more Potassium and 2.4 times more Water than Bread, white, commercially prepared, low sodium, no salt.
- While 1 kg of Bread, white, commercially prepared, low sodium, no salt contains 2.7 times more Calcium, 3.4 times more Copper, 33.7 times more Iron, 2.4 times more Magnesium, 16.7 times more Manganese, 5.5 times more Phosphorus, more Sodium and 10.3 times more Zinc than Raw Valencia Oranges.
- 1 kilogram of Valencia Oranges lack sufficient amounts of Iron, Manganese and Zinc
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 1 kilogram:
- 1 kg of Bread, white, commercially prepared, low sodium, no salt contains 5.4 times more Energy, 12 times more Fat, 23.2 times more Saturated Fat, 2.2 times more Omega 3, 16.1 times more Omega 6, 4.2 times more Carbohydrate and 7.9 times more Protein than Raw Valencia Oranges.
- Both Valencia Oranges and Bread, white, commercially prepared, low sodium, no salt offer comparable quantities of Fiber per one kilogram.
- 1 kilogram of Valencia Oranges provide inadequate amounts of Energy, Omega 3, Omega 6 and Protein
